Read the latest magazine Industry News Merchants MKM Building Supplies Expands in Scotland with Spey Valley Acquisition 4 August 2021 MKM BUILDING SUPPLIES, the UK’s largest independent builders merchant, is expanding its presence in Scotland with the purchase of Spey Valley Timber & Builders Merchants. The acquisition follows a period of growth in Scotland, with new MKM branches in Inverness in July and Peterhead in September. The addition of Spey Valley gives MKM’s Scottish network to 17 branches. Founded in the 1980s, Spey Valley Timber & Builders Merchants is a locally owned independent business that supplies building materials, equipment and accessories to tradespeople throughout Aviemore and the wider Scottish Highlands.
